The keyboard is super processed and is very sturdy. The cable, which is quite rigid, is encased and can thus protect them from sharp glass edges. It is also acceptable, which brings with it the advantage that with a defective cable is not the whole keyboard is unusable, but you can easily replace it with a new one.
A PS2 adapter included, which provides an 8-fold signal transmission. I had with macro keys previously no experience and am therefore very pleased that the assignment is kept as simple. 300 characters can be assigned to each all eight macros, which I think is a great achievement, but I do not know how it is in other keyboards. That the macro keys are located above the keyboard, in my opinion, is to make more sense as you can so it lay in playing the finger next to each other and can not press a button when they are arranged among themselves. The keyboard has four modes: Once you can illuminate the entire keyboard, only the WASD keys, only the arrow keys or completely out! With a software you would normally be able to decide which keys you want to have lighted, and it can be adapted to suit his game.
As usual with a gaming keyboard, there are also here a gaming key which disables the Windows key and the two can not be kicked accidentally from a game like this.
